After Paypal approves that the refund is valid, you are told to ship the item(s) back to the seller and provide Paypal with a tracking number.
The Seller confirms receipt of the item or Paypal will confirm receipt via the tracking number.
Paypal then issues the refund. At least that is how it worked for me.
